By mid-November, prices had climbed to $617.50 before softening slightly. The choppy trend in lumber futures, compounded by the market\u2019s infamous illiquidity, sets the stage for significant price volatility in 2025.<\/p>\n<p>The CME\u2019s physical lumber futures contract, introduced in 2022, was designed to improve market accessibility with a smaller contract size and flexible delivery locations. Yet, with only 5,960 contracts of open interest and average daily volumes of about 1,000 contracts, liquidity remains thin. This lack of liquidity has historically resulted in exaggerated price movements when demand or supply shocks hit the market, and this year could prove no different.<\/p>\n<p>One immediate driver of demand is the aftermath of the January 2025 wildfires in Los Angeles. The scale of the destruction has triggered the need for significant rebuilding efforts, which are likely to require substantial amounts of lumber. While the Federal Reserve reduced short-term rates by 100 basis points in 2024 and plans a further 50 basis point cut in 2025, long-term borrowing costs remain elevated. High mortgage rates have dampened demand for new homes, particularly as home prices remain high due to a tight housing market. Homeowners locked into low, fixed-rate mortgages are holding onto their properties, reducing the inventory of homes for sale. However, if mortgage rates begin to decline, pent-up demand for homeownership could quickly spark a surge in construction and, by extension, lumber demand.<\/p>\n<p>Technical analysis of the lumber market highlights key support at $530.50 and resistance at $623.50. Breaking through resistance could trigger a rally similar to those seen in 2021 and 2022, especially as construction activity tends to peak in spring. Past trends show that lumber prices often reach their annual highs during this season, making the months ahead critical for market participants.<\/p>\n<p>Despite the current range-bound trading, bullish factors such as rebuilding efforts, tariff impacts, and the potential for lower mortgage rates could ignite a rally. However, the market remains sensitive to bearish influences, including persistently high long-term interest rates and the affordability challenges they impose on homebuyers.<\/p>\n<p>Lumber remains a critical barometer for the U.S. economy. While its illiquid futures market may not offer a reliable trading environment, its price movements provide insights into broader economic trends. As we look ahead to 2025, the interplay between demand drivers and supply constraints will determine whether lumber prices will break out of their current range or remain subdued.
